HfAuO3 is an experimental mixed-metal oxide ceramic composed of hafnium, gold, and oxygen. This compound belongs to the family of complex oxides and perovskite-related structures currently under research investigation, with potential applications in high-temperature electronics and catalysis. The incorporation of gold into a hafnium oxide matrix is notable for exploring novel electronic and catalytic properties not readily available in conventional binary oxides, though industrial adoption remains limited pending further development and characterization.
